

Lewisia columbiana var. wallowensis
A compact, alpine perennial known for its showy, star-shaped pale pink to white flowers with delicate striping, blooming in tight rosettes of fleshy, succulent evergreen leaves.
Native Range:
Endemic to the Wallowa Mountains of northeastern Oregon, typically found on rocky slopes, talus, and subalpine ridges.
Ideal for rock gardens, troughs, and alpine collections, this rare variety thrives in sharply drained soils and full sun, reflecting its high-elevation origins.
